This annual, statewide contest encourages students in 3rd, 4th, and 5th grades to be creative and learn about the natural environment around them! The theme for the 2024-2025 school year is Wetlands are Wonderful

Submission Deadlines

  • Posters are due on Friday, January 31st, 2025.

Requirements

  • Posters should display content relevant to the nature of conservation and this year's theme. 
    • The importance of wetlands, their role in our ecosystem, and ways to protect them could be highlighted on the poster.
  • Posters should be the work of individual students - no group posters.
  • Poster size: no smaller than 22"' x 28'' and no larger than 24" x 36"
  • Each poster must have the student's name, grade, teacher's name, and school written on the back.
  • Have fun and be creative!

Judging

  • Posters will be judged on the following points
    • 50% - Conservation message
    • 25% - Visual effectiveness
    • 10% - Universal appeal
    • 10% - Originality
    • 5% - Hand-drawn elements
  • Infractions
    • 5 points - Copyright violation
    • 5 points - Exceeds or is under size limits

Awards

  • The 1st place county winner from each grade level will receive an award and advance to the Area competition, with the chance of going to the state competition.
